Manufacturer :
Vishay
Product Category :
Transistors - FETs, MOSFETs - Single
Packaging :
Tape and Reel (TR)
REACH SVHC :
Unknown
Current :
2A
Input Capacitance (Ciss) (Max) @ Vds :
400pF @ 25V
Power Dissipation :
2W
Terminal Position :
Dual
Width :
3.7mm
Height :
1.8mm
Operating Mode :
ENHANCEMENT MODE
Number of Channels :
1
Mounting Type :
Surface Mount
Transistor Application :
SWITCHING
Threshold Voltage :
2V
Configuration :
SINGLE WITH BUILT-IN DIODE
Voltage :
55V
Number of Pins :
4
Turn On Delay Time :
9.3 ns
Fall Time (Typ) :
26 ns
Rise Time :
110ns
Number of Terminations :
3
Transistor Element Material :
SILICON
Peak Reflow Temperature (Cel) :
260
Package / Case :
TO-261-4, TO-261AA
Operating Temperature :
-55°C~150°C TJ
Resistance :
200mOhm
Case Connection :
DRAIN
Current - Continuous Drain (Id) @ 25°C :
2.7A Tc
Vgs (Max) :
±10V
Pin Count :
4
Nominal Vgs :
1 V
Mount :
Surface Mount
Terminal Form :
Gull wing
Rds On (Max) @ Id, Vgs :
200m Ω @ 1.6A, 5V
Continuous Drain Current (ID) :
2.7A
Gate Charge (Qg) (Max) @ Vgs :
8.4nC @ 5V
Power Dissipation-Max :
2W Ta 3.1W Tc
RoHS Status :
ROHS3 Compliant
ECCN Code :
EAR99
Drive Voltage (Max Rds On,Min Rds On) :
4V 5V
Radiation Hardening :
No
Vgs(th) (Max) @ Id :
2V @ 250μA
Gate to Source Voltage (Vgs) :
10V
Moisture Sensitivity Level (MSL) :
1 (Unlimited)
Length :
6.7mm
Time@Peak Reflow Temperature-Max (s) :
40
Drain to Source Breakdown Voltage :
60V
Number of Elements :
1
Weight :
250.212891mg
Additional Feature :
LOGIC LEVEL COMPATIBLE
Published :
2011
JESD-30 Code :
R-PDSO-G3
FET Type :
N-Channel
Lead Free :
Lead Free
Turn-Off Delay Time :
17 ns
Factory Lead Time :
8 Weeks
